For most of us, gaming means sitting down in a comfy chair and indulging in a deep narrative, some exciting gameplay mechanics, or a bit of healthy competition—but the medium is by no means limited to entertainment. Enter the “serious game”.

From national defence and city planning to scientific endeavour and education, the serious game is a vital part of gaming which is often left out of the discussion.

When studied, serious games yielded some great results from adult learners—with participants displaying 9% higher retention rates and 14% higher skill-based knowledge. In short, the serious game is clearly an effective form of training.

Let’s take a closer look at a number of industries which already use the serious game to train their professionals.



Health Sectors

Healthcare is a sector which heavily utilises serious games in order to both train professionals and undergo various simulations.

Most notably dentists and surgeons can benefit greatly from simulations of surgeries, both in order to learn procedures and to practice them. Thanks to the rise of VR and AR, these simulations are getting more and more effective, allowing surgeons to use tools which reflect their real-world counterparts. Platforms like OssoVR provide these types of simulations.

Military “games”

While the entertainment side of gaming may be jam-packed with military-themed experiences, few of them get anywhere near the reality of warfare. So, although many military establishments use serious games to prepare their soldiers for any and every situation, they are not using those titles you’ll find on the shelf in a store.

Instead, serious games like America’s Army place trainees in complex situations allowing them to come to terms with the key tenets of military service in a safe, controlled environment.

Again, the military are also well known for utilising virtual reality in their training programs, as it’s immersive capabilities allow soldiers to get a much more realistic—and thus more educational—experience of the trials and tribulations they may face in the line of duty.

HGV Drivers

We all know how popular Euro Truck Simulator and the many other vehicular simulators are, but for the real-world drivers of such vehicles, serious games can help prevent disaster on the open road.

Most eminently, serious games can help teach truck drivers how to identify hazardous conditions, and how to react if they find themselves confronting them. This sees them face virtual ice, hail, road accidents and much more to better prepare them for the real thing.

Beyond truck drivers, there are also a large amount of other driving simulators, such as forklift simulators These help to teach forklift drivers how to safely and efficiently operate within the catastrophe-prone environment of a warehouse. It’s worth noting that this form of engaging with such professionals is far more effective than traditional and generic safety videos and paperwork.

Astronauts

It’s no secret that astronauts have an intense training regimen—be it in centrifuges to train them to withstand multiple G-forces or in virtual scenarios to deal with disaster. The various serious game utilised by astronaut training programs help to promote teamwork, level moods and prepare astronauts for a variety of different scenarios which could easily catch them off-guard in space.

The teams behind space travel also use a variety of incredibly complex simulations to map out spaceflight and plan for long voyages—but, of course, these move more into the realm of purpose-built simulations rather than serious games.

Pilots

While flight simulators have leeched over into the sphere of commercial game, they are still very much a part of a pilot’s training and have been for over 80 years. From the pneumatically actuates flight simulators to those on a screen, these simulators equip pilots with the skills necessary to keep planes up in the air no matter the weather, or what disaster may strike. The integration of virtual reality and advanced biometrics has pushed flight simulators even further, bringing a pilot’s early training one step closer to the reality of flying. It’s also worth noting that these advances in technology have produced notably faster results—seeing pilots being certified in a brief 4-months instead of the year that the traditional system requires.

Teambuilding

While serious games are often quite, for want of a better word, serious simulations, it’s worth noting that other types of games can also be incredibly useful in the workplace. This is most commonly seen through gaming experiences used to fast-forward teambuilding. The logic of using co-operative games to help solidify teams is a relative no-brainer as games with team-oriented goals naturally bring people together and promote interaction where there may otherwise be tentativeness or awkwardness. From saving lives to transporting people/goods and building teams, we have seen that gaming has an incredibly important place in the professional workplace. By providing personnel in training with safe, simulated environments for them to learn within their ability to learn is often fast-forwarded as they can comfortably make mistakes and learn from them instantly.

So the next time you’re discussing the importance of gaming, remember that it has an essential place in the training regimes of many sectors—making it not only one of the most widely enjoyed forms of entertainment today, but also one of the most important.
